Italy is an underrated shout when it comes to studies abroad. The country is home to more than 50 world-class institutions. When it comes to courses, Fashion and Design, Architecture, Engineering, Arts & Humanities, Business & Economics are some of the stand-out options available to students. According to QS World the Politecnico Di Milano, Sapienza University of Rome, University of Bologna, and the University of Padova are some of the best institutions in the world to pursue higher studies from. Furthermore, the cost of living in Italy is almost 40% lower than the countries like the USA, UK, Canada, and Australia. At present, the country has around 32,000 international students including 12,000+ Indian students are studying in Italy.
Latest Update on India - Italy Accord
The Union Cabinet has given post facto approval to the Migration and Mobility Agreement between Italy and India. This agreement would enhance people-to-people contacts, encourage mobility of students, business people, skilled workers, professional trainings, and strengthen cooperation on issues regarding irregular migration between India and Italy.

Why Study in Italy?
Some key factors which make Italy an ideal destination to study abroad include: affordable higher education, varied offered courses, work and study balance, an opportunity to learn a foreign language, etc. Presence of top-ranked universities, home to a few of the leading fashion brands of the world, and lower cost of living are a few of the reasons why international students want to study in Italy. We have mentioned below some other popular reasons that make Italy a better choice to study for Indian students:
- Affordability- Education at Italy universities offer affordable costs as compared to some of the more popular universities in countries such as US, UK and Canada.
- Top Job Sectors- Among the sectors with the highest number of jobs in Italy are Manufacturing, Healthcare, Information Technology, Education, Finance, etc.

Best Engineering Universities in Italy
Listed below are the best Engineering universities in Italy for Indian students:
| University |
QS 2025 Rank |
|---|---|
| Politecnico Di Milano |
#21 |
| Politecnico di Torino |
#55 |
| Sapienza University of Rome |
#93 |
| University of Bologna |
#111 |
| University of Padova |
#165 |
| University of Naples - Federico II |
#173 |
| University of Pisa |
#244 |
| University of Trento |
#292 |
| University of Rome Tor Vergata |
#328 |
Best Business & Management Universities in Italy
Given below is a list of the top-ranked universities for Business & Management in Italy in QS subject rankings:
| University |
QS 2025 Rank |
|---|---|
| Bocconi University |
#10 |
| Politecnico di Milano |
#64 |
| Luiss University |
#67 |
| University of Bologna |
#129 |
| Sapienza University of Rome |
#251-300 |
| University Cattolica del Sacro Cuore |
#301-350 |
| Politecnico di Torino |
#351-400 |
| University of Milan |
#401-450 |
| University of Rome Tor Vergata |
#401-450 |
| University of Padova |
#401-450 |

Cost of Studying in Italy
On average, the cost of studying in Italy is relatively affordable as compared to other popular study-abroad options for Indian students. The cost of studying in Italy varies from university to university. The first-year tuition fee is within the range of INR 10 L. The tuition fees for a few Italian Universities are given as follows:
| Universities |
Annual Tuition Fees |
|---|---|
| University of Bologna |
INR 1 L - INR 4 L |
| Sapienza University of Rome |
INR 3 L |
| Politecnico Di Milano |
INR 4 L - INR 40 L |
| University of Padova |
INR 3 L |
| University of Pisa |
INR 3 L |
| University of Naples |
INR 3 L |

Cost of Living in Italy
The average cost of living in Italy for international students is around EUR 8,400 (Around INR 9.24 L). The division for the living expenses in Italy are given as follows:
| Particulars |
Cost (in EUR) |
Cost (in INR) |
|---|---|---|
| Annual Cost of Living |
EUR 3,800 - EUR 5,500 approx. |
INR 4.18 L-INR 6.05 L |
| Rented Accommodation Cost in Italy |
EUR 200 - EUR 600 per month |
INR 22 K-INR 66 K |
| Average Cost of Living in Italy for Students |
EUR 1,500 - EUR 2,400 annually |
INR 1.65 L-INR 2.64 L |
| On-Campus Housing |
EUR 200 - EUR 300 per year |
INR 22 K-INR 33 K |
| Cost of Food |
EUR 200 - EUR 300 per month |
INR 22 K-INR 33 K |
| Personal Expenses |
EUR 200 or above per year |
INR 22 K |
1 EUR = INR 110

Job Opportunities in Italy
Italy is one of the top countries to study for international students. Naturally, it is important to know the job prospects and popular job sectors. Some of the top job sectors in Italy are ICT and Retail and Business. Teacher, Copywriter, Financial Analyst, Graphic Designer, Product Manager, Software Engineer, Web Developer, etc. are some of the top job roles in Italy. The annual average salary for an international student working in Italy is between EUR 13,000 – EUR 38,000 (INR 14.25 L – INR 41.67 L). The popular job sectors in Italy are:
| Top Job Roles in Italy |
Average Annual Salary (in EUR) |
Average Annual Salary (in INR) |
|---|---|---|
| Accountant |
€31,500 |
INR 34.54 L |
| Mechanical Engineer |
€31,013 |
INR 34.01 L |
| Business Analyst |
€31,188 |
INR 34.20 L |
| Graduate Research Assistant (GRA) |
€17,810 |
INR 19.53 L |
| Operations Manager |
€45,960 |
INR 50.40 L |
| Software Engineer |
€33,427 |
INR 36.66 L |
| Legal Counsel |
€47,500 |
INR 52.09 L |
| Sales Associate |
€30,521 |
INR 33.47 L |
Source: Payscale
